Abstract

The invention provides a fiber which is superior in safety, can be conveniently produced, and has organic solvent resistance, as well as a starting material composition for producing the fiber and a biocompatible material containing the fiber. The fiber is produced by spinning a composition containing (A) a condensation product obtained by condensing one or more kinds of a compound represented by the formula (1), and (B) an acid compound: wherein each symbol is as defined herein.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A fiber produced by spinning a composition comprising
 (A) a condensation product obtained by condensing one or more kinds of a compound represented by the formula (1), and   (B) an acid compound:   
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
       wherein
 R 1  is an amino group optionally substituted by an alkoxymethyl group having 2-6 carbon atoms or a hydroxymethyl group, an alkyl group having 1-6 carbon atoms, an alkenyl group having 2-6 carbon atoms or an aryl group having 6-14 carbon atoms; and 
 R 2 , R 3 , R 4  and R 5  are the same or different and each is a hydrogen atom, a hydroxymethyl group, an alkoxymethyl group having 2-6 carbon atoms, an alkenyl group having 2-6 carbon atoms or an alkyl group having 1-6 carbon atoms. 
 
     
     
         2 . The fiber according to  claim 1 , wherein the above-mentioned composition further comprises (C) a solvent.
